Ozzfest was an annual music festival tour of the United States and sometimes Europe and later Japan, featuring performances by many heavy metal and hard rock musical groups. It was founded by Sharon Osbourne [ 1 ] and her husband Ozzy Osbourne , [ 2 ] both of whom also organised each yearly tour with their son Jack Osbourne , [ 3 ] and was held ...

We Sold Our Souls for Rock 'n Roll is a 2001 documentary by Penelope Spheeris.It was filmed at the 1999 Ozzfest [1] and won an award for "Most Popular Documentary" at the 2001 Melbourne International Film Festival. [2]
